Isabel’s Beach House

This small Marthas Vineyard inn offers the warm and attentive service that has made it popular as Oak Bluffs’ favorite waterfront b & b.

  • Address: 83 Seaview Avenue

    Oak Bluffs, (Massachusetts) 02557 
  • City: Oak Bluffs 
  • State: Massachusetts 
  • Phone Number: 5086933955 
  • Website: www.isabellesbeachhouse.com 
  • Tollfree Phone: (800) 674-3129 
  • Amenities: WiFi, Complimentary Breakfast, Hair Dryer 

Leave a Reply

Your email address will not be published. Required fields are marked *